The interior of southern Africa is covered by the Southern Plateau. This is an area of grasslands suitable for crops and grazing. The Drakensburg Mountains run along the edge of the plateau between it and the coast in the south and west. The Namib Desert runs along the southwest coast across the Tropic of Capricorn. Inland, in the center of the ring of coastal mountains, is the Kalahari Desert. The Cape of Good Hope is a point of land that marks the continent's southwest corner.
